Dale Earnhardt Jr. Signs Deal With WME To Assist With Various Off-Track Ventures

NASCAR driver Dale Earnhardt Jr. after an extensive review has "signed a deal" with WME, which his current management team "hopes will help him capitalize on his brand," according to Adam Stern in this week's SPORTSBUSINESS JOURNAL. The deal will see WME "assist Earnhardt in his various off-track business ventures." Earnhardt's internal team -- which also includes JR Motorsports Managing Dir of Brand & Digital Media Mike Davis and Dir of Brand Marketing & Partnerships Tony Mayhoff -- will "continue to manage Earnhardt's many businesses." However, WME will "consult on how to increase existing revenue streams." Earnhardt's team "decided about a year ago to look into outside representation and requested proposals from agencies that would help them do a full review of his brand for the first time." Earnhardt's team said that the structure of the relationship is "based off of commission, and the financial split from new deals will be figured out on a case-by-case basis" (SPORTSBUSINESS JOURNAL, 5/15 issue).
